In colonial America, how was the House of Burgesses significant?

Respuesta :

notamuggle0731 notamuggle0731
  • 03-02-2022

Answer:

it was the first representative government in the new world, it helped lay the foundation for america by showing that these settlers valued their rights and wanted to have a say in the government and not be ruled by a single king
